Job Summary :

The Chief Operating Officer (COO) provides executive oversight and management of the operational, financial, and human resource functions for St. Louis Catholic Church and School. This role is vital in supporting the mission “to unite God’s people in the sacraments, steward His generosity, and evangelize the community.” The COO ensures that parish and school operations reflect this mission through prudent financial management, effective oversight of facilities, and collaborative leadership with staff and ministry leaders.

The COO works closely with the Pastor, Principal, Executive Director of Mission, and advisory councils to manage resources efficiently, develop and monitor budgets, and foster operational excellence. Additionally, the COO oversees key ministries, including the Food Pantry, Engagement and Worship Office, and Early Childhood Development Center, requiring close coordination with the Executive Director of Mission to ensure seamless execution and alignment with the parish mission. This position requires an individual with a strong sense of stewardship, leadership, and a pastoral approach to working with others.

Essential Job Duties :

Financial Management

  • Oversee the combined parish and school budgets, totaling over $6 million annually, ensuring alignment with organizational goals and financial sustainability.
  • Collaborate with the Principal and School Advisory Board to develop and monitor the school budget (~$3M).
  • Lead the development and oversight of the parish budget (~$3M) in collaboration with the Parish Finance Council and Pastor.
  • Provide financial oversight of payroll, accounts payable / receivable, weekly collections, and reporting processes.
  • Prepare and present financial reports to the Pastor, Principal, Parish Finance Council, and School Advisory Board for informed decision-making.
  • Ensure compliance with diocesan requirements by collaborating with the Diocese of Austin’s Finance, HR, and Legal departments.

Human Resources

  • Oversee all HR functions, including hiring, onboarding, performance management, and terminations, in compliance with diocesan policies.
  • Maintain and update Employee and Operations manuals to reflect current guidelines and best practices.
  • Foster a mission-driven workplace culture that encourages professional growth and accountability.
  • Ministry Oversight

  • Manage the Food Pantry, Engagement and Worship Office, and Early Childhood Development Center, ensuring effective operations and mission alignment.
  • Provide direct supervision to department managers and directors, fostering collaboration and accountability.
  • Coordinate closely with the Executive Director of Mission to support the strategic and operational goals of these ministries.
  • Facilities Management

  • Provide oversight of the Director of Facilities for the maintenance and management of 12 buildings and 20 acres of parish and school property.
  • Collaborate with the Pastor on capital improvement projects and facility use policies.
  • Ensure compliance with city regulations, permits, and property-related requirements.
  • Operational Leadership

  • Assist the Principal with operational, financial, and HR matters to support the school’s mission and goals.
  • Provide oversight for the Technology Director, ensuring accountability while maintaining their direct reporting relationship to the Principal.
  • Serve as a key member of the Executive Team, advising the Pastor on operational strategies to support the parish mission.
  • Policy and Compliance

  • Develop and implement internal controls to safeguard resources and ensure operational integrity.
  • Ensure compliance with diocesan and legal requirements, collaborating with diocesan departments as necessary.
  •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ities :

  • Strong commitment to the Catholic faith and a pastoral approach to leadership.
  • Knowledge of the teachings and structure of the Roman Catholic Church.
  • Experience in financial management, including budgeting and forecasting.
  • Effective leadership and communication skills, with the ability to collaborate with clergy, staff, and advisory councils.
  • Proficient in the use of Microsoft Office and other administrative tools.
  • Ability to organize and prioritize multiple responsibilities effectively.
  • Requirements

    Minimum Qualifications :

  • Education :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Finance, or a related field (Master’s preferred).
  • Experience : Minimum of 8 years in operations management, including budget oversight, HR, and facilities management.
  • Experience in a Catholic parish with a school strongly preferred.
  • Licenses / Certifications :
  • Valid Texas driver’s license.
  • Must maintain compliance with the Diocese of Austin Ethics and Integrity in Ministry (EIM) policies.
